Fathers Network Schedules 2016 Conference

August 8, 2016 By UW READi Lab

The Washington State Fathers Network (WSFN) provides information, support, and resources for fathers of children with special needs. Their focus is on assisting fathers as they become more competent and compassionate caregivers for their children. In addition to connecting men with other dads, WSFN provides opportunities for “all family” gatherings and celebrations.  This year their annual conference will take place on October 8th at Tyee Middle School in Bellevue. The conference will include a keynote talk from Dr. Joel Domingo, a former UW LEND Fellow, and several breakout sessions on topics such as parenting skills and understanding insurance benefits.
